    The hotel lobby is only a 2 minute walk to the beach. This particular part of the beach is perfect for little kids and those who don't like waves since there's a breaker (is that the right word?) If you want waves, you can walk another minute to a nearby beach where you can rent surfboards or play in the water. The lobby reception desk helped me check in after 12am (there were still two people working the desk because they had heard our flight was delayed three hours--and they were expecting us and others from our flight!) They got us to our room quickly. The bed was very comfortable. The view was nice (partial ocean). Hotel breakfast buffet was yummy and about the average price of a California buffet, $17 (which seems reasonable since all other food from the surrounding area was outrageously priced). I loved the pool area. There were two pools to choose from, both on the third floor with views of the ocean and comfy lounge seats. It was beautiful. I visited on a particularly rainy week in December so I spent more time in the jacuzzi than the ocean. Big bed. A lot of pillows. Cable TV. Balcony with two chairs and a table--great for reading. The only thing I don't like about Waikiki in general (not the hotels fault) is that there are a ton of homeless transients around, some of them kind of scary. But I'd stay there again.
